Roles & Responsibilities

  • Ensure month end closing and completion as per timeline.
  • Lead the team to review balance sheet items with the team to ensure no long outstanding without valid reason.
  • Ensuring correct general ledger usage on the transactions and mapping with BPC.
  • Ensure fixed assets management complies with SOP in terms of acquisition, depreciation computations, traceability, records and disposal.
  • Preparation and coordination of annual budget for operation expenditures.
  • Involved in contributing relevant decision making and ideas during difficult situation / solving issues both within and with other departments ie issues on month end closing, system processes for Finance and Logistics, Accounts Payable related matters.
  • Organize, train, and coach team to carry out work and provide guidance in solving issues,
  • Ensure work is carried out in accordance with the SOP.

Ideal Candidate

  • Bachelor's degree in accountancy.
  • Possess professional accountancy membership (e.g. ACCA/CPA/ICAEW/MIA).
  • Minimum of 5 years working experience in FMCG industry.
  • Experience working in an MNC is an added advantage.
  • Effective communication abilities to engage with individuals at all organizational levels
  • A proactive attitude with the ability to multitask and manage priorities effectively.
  • Strong attention to detail and willingness to learn.
